Applications are now open for the 2026 Mo Ibrahim Foundation Leadership Fellowship Programme. Launched in 2011, this prestigious fellowship identifies and nurtures the next generation of outstanding African leaders, equipping them with the skills, networks, and mentorship needed to shape the continent’s future.
Fellowship Overview
Each year, three Fellows are selected to serve in the executive offices of:
- The African Development Bank (AfDB) in Abidjan
- The Economic Commission for Africa (ECA) in Addis Ababa
- The International Trade Centre (ITC) in Geneva
Over the course of 12 months, Fellows gain invaluable experience by working on research, policy design, and executive-level initiatives, while receiving direct mentorship from the heads of these host organisations.
Fellowship Benefits
Successful applicants will receive:
- $100,000 stipend for the fellowship year
- 12 months of hands-on professional experience in leading African and global institutions
- Mentorship from senior leaders of AfDB, ECA, or ITC
- Membership in the Now Generation Network (NGN), an active community of young African leaders continuing to drive change beyond the fellowship
Eligibility Criteria
Applicants must:
- Be nationals of African countries
- Hold a Master’s degree
- Have a minimum of 7 years relevant professional experience
- Be under 40 years old, or under 45 for women with children
(Additional requirements may vary by host institution.)
